Hi Soren,

Welcome to on-call for the Hargrove telemetry gateway! Quick heads-up before Thursday's release: the gateway buffers tractor sensor data for up to an hour if the uplink drops, so a quiet dashboard isn't always a healthy one. Check queue depth first, always. The runbook and escalation order are on the internal page below.

operations page: https://jenkins.zemvarcloud.local/job/merge_requests/repo/build/73930b4b30f0a8ed

**Ticket: PAY-2291 — Flaky integration tests after credential expiry**

The Coinstep integration suite has been failing intermittently since Monday. Root cause: the sandbox credential for the Vaultgate token service expired, so roughly half the test runs hit cached tokens and pass while the rest fail on refresh. This explains the flakiness rather than a genuine race. I've provisioned a replacement credential with the same scopes; please update the CI secret with the key below.

service key, hahaf-tahaf: kto4_7pQP

## Deploying the Gatewick Proctor Queue

Deploys are pretty painless: push to main, wait for the pipeline, then watch the queue drain dashboard for five minutes. If candidates pile up mid-exam, roll back first and ask questions later — the queue replays safely. Everything the workers care about lives in one config block, shown here for reference.

settings of bafof-yagef:
JOROX_PIN=8740
JOROX_TENANT=pelox
JOROX_METRICS_HOST=metrics.jorox.qorvelworks.internal
JOROX_SEAL=seal_c78f63c1
JOROX_STANDBY_TEAM=norax

## Configuration

Vexhall delivers webhooks with exponential backoff: 5 attempts, starting at 2s, capped at 5m. A 2xx response stops retries. 410 responses disable the endpoint permanently. Duplicate deliveries are possible; deduplicate on the event ID header. Retry state persists across Vexhall restarts, so do not assume order. Plugins must verify the HMAC signature on every attempt, including retries. Set the signing secret in your plugin's .env with this line:

vault entry, hahaf-tafog: VAULT_KEY3=38a